I was thinking about this again this morning, and my last post isn't very accurate. Now that you have already drawn the permit, you don't get to choose the method. The 2nd deer permits specify which tag is required. So your permit is a modern firearm, muzzleloader, or archery permit, and THAT is the tag you need to have to go with it.
But, it is true that having the multi-season tag did allow you to apply for any of the 2nd deer permits, regardless of which tag they required.

I don't think the proposed fee list is written correctly, the new one adds the price of a small game license to the tag on the higher price listed. But you can get a idea from this.
Old: Deer License= $42.30 (in the regs it says $45.20) , Second Deer Permit $26.00 in the 2011 regs
New (tomorrow): $42.90, second deer permit not listed... but based on what has been done before I dont expect it'll change very much.
Old/Current: https://fishhunt.dfw.wa.gov/wdfw/licenses_fees.html (https://fishhunt.dfw.wa.gov/wdfw/licenses_fees.html)
New/Tomorrow: http://wdfw.wa.gov/licensing/license_fees.html (http://wdfw.wa.gov/licensing/license_fees.html)
biggest changes are Deer, Elk, Bear, Cougar Combo: Old= List $79.20, Regs say $81.20, NEW= $93.50
Moose, Bighorn, Goats go from $122 to $330
Bear and Cougar go from $24 for both to $22 each
Quality special hunt apps go from $6 to $13.20
Combo fishing up from $46.50 to $52.25
